AR226-2821 1 Copies co: E I* du Pont de Nemours and Company Haskell Laboratory lor Toxicology and Industrial Medicine TEN-DOSE SUBACUTE ORAL TEST (RATS) Procedure : The test material (H-3824) was administered dally by stomach tube to each of six young adult ChR-CD male rats, five times a week for two weeks. Groups of three test rats, along with controls, were sacrificed four hours and 14 days after the last treatment. Does not contain TSCA CBI ACUTE SKIN ABSORPTION TEST (RABBITS) g.F9cedur^ >e test material (H-3825), as received, was applied in single doses to the finely clipped skin of male albino rabbits and rubbed in lightly with a glass rod. The animals were restrained in wooden stocks for 24 hours, after which the skin was washed with warm water. Survivors were killed 14 days later.
